Once Ulfric had armour that fitted him properly, the Legate permitted him to take a small party of scouts or hunters every second day, so that the Quaestor could familiarise himself with the terrain. None of the men and women Ulfric picked were mer, and none of them were Rikke.

Rikke tried not to feel insulted or neglected - after all, it would be highly irregular for a Quaestor to take someone of the same rank on a scouting trip but given their relationship, and the fact that before his abduction they had been inseparable except by duty, one might think he would relish the opportunity to fight back-to-back with her again.

"Well, he hasn't spoken his mind to me, Quaestor Rikke," the Legate replied irritably, when Rikke wondered aloud why Ulfric was avoiding her. "The only one he talks to is that damned Housecarl of his."

*-*

Galmar opened the tent flap and glared at her. "No. He won't see you tonight. Stop chasing him."

"It's not him I'm after, tonight. Walk with me, Galmar," Rikke replied in steely tones.

Galmar ducked back inside briefly, presumably telling Ulfric where he was going, and joined her outside again. "Make this quick. He needs me," he said bluntly.

"And not me? By the Nine, Galmar, does he think I ratted him out to the elves?"

Galmar sighed, and rubbed his eyes tiredly. He looked a decade older than he had just a few scant weeks before, prior to Ulfric's abduction. "Of course not, woman. But a man has to have some pride. He needs to get back on his feet before he can ask for a hand up. You know you cannot force a Nord to accept help he hasn't asked for.

"He tolerates me because I've always been there. You? You're new, you're different, and for you he needs to be strong and independent and worthy. That is going to take time. Lots of time. You are probably the second best thing that ever happened to him, after me, but you need to be patient with him. They stomped all over him - body and mind - with dirty great big torture boots. He's still Ulfric, but he's not your Ulfric - not yet.

"Wait, Rikke. Wait for Ulfric to come to you. If you push too hard he'll pull back completely, and that won't help anyone. Please," Galmar pleased with her.

"I - I need to think about this," Rikke stammered, wondering if that was a speech Ulfric had prepared for Galmar, or if Galmar really saw it that way.

"Take your time," Galmar said, gripping her shoulder as he passed her to return to Ulfric.

"Galmar," Ulfric addressed his Housecarl a few mornings later. "Have you heard about the action down near Anvil? I have requested to transfer there, to be in the thick of the fighting. My Thu'um will be of more use there against the Dominion than here against the Healers. Or in the Reach against petty rebels."

"And have you spoken to Rikke about this?" Galmar asked pointedly.

Ulfric seemed to deflate slightly at the mention of his lover. "Rikke. I - no, I have not spoken to her, Galmar. I - I would not ask her to tie herself to one as deformed as I. And - it - it is for the best if we end things now. Before - before it gets ... difficult."

"Difficult for whom? You haven't given her a chance since I brought you back to her," Galmar pointed out. "She pesters me morning, noon and night for word of you, your wounds, your recovery, your heart and your head. She will not take this well. Or did you intend for her to join us?"

Ulfric looked alarmed. "And place her at the heart of the danger? Never, Galmar!"

"Ulfric, may I be frank and honest with you?"

"As if you are ever anything else," Ulfric muttered, nodding.

"She loves you and you love her. Stop being an idiot and let her love you."

"I ... must think on what you have said to me," Ulfric murmured, and left the tent.

He didn't tell me where he'd be going, or for how long. He's getting better, Galmar thought, approvingly.

*-*-*

Galmar went about the business of preparing for travel, occasionally glancing uphill to the fallen tree where Ulfric and Rikke sat, conferring privately. He hoped Ulfric wouldsee sense and bring Rikke - or stay here with her - because it was so much easier to look after his Jarl's son if someone else helped him do it, someone else with Ulfric's best interests at heart.

Later, after he had eaten, Galmar was on his way back to the tent when Rikke stopped him. She was pale and shaking in livid rage. She drew back her arm and slapped Galmar as hard as she could, staggering the bigger man. She was drawing back to repeat the action, but Galmar was quicker, grabbing her and pinning her so she could hurt neither him nor herself.

"I let you do it once, but do not think to raise a hand in anger against me ever again, Rikke," he said through gritted teeth.

"He'll take you but not me? Are you a better fuck than I am?" Rikke spat.

Galmar tightened his grip, knowing he would leave bruises there in the morning. "Do not make the mistake of thinking you are the only person who loves Ulfric - and do not make the mistake of thinking that my loyalty was won in bed. I've known him my whole life, you've known him barely a year. He needs time. Time to heal and time to remember who he was before the thrice-damned witch-elves took him. You did not even lift a finger to help bring him back!"

Rikke fought and squirmed, and finnaly got free from Galmar's grasp. "He and I are nothing to one another, save one Quaestor to another, now."

Galmar nodded sadly. "That's a shame. You were almost as good at looking after him as me."

"You leave tomorrow, I take it?" Rikke asked, all the fight going out of her.

"At daybreak, or so he tells me," Galmar nodded.

"Take care of him, for me, will you?"

"Only every minute. Rikke, maybe when this damned war is done, you and Ulfric might find some common ground again," Galmar said hopefully.

"I hope so, friend."

"So do I."
